Transaction 27545a1b6782066f013907665dc80bc5f7e58428170980c11aa1ed5fb2fd3036
1 Input
1 Output
-
27545a1b6782066f013907665dc80bc5f7e58428170980c11aa1ed5fb2fd3036:0
- value
- 3337748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f91d4f8ac156344338b6255f3691b3700d932e OP_EQUAL
- address
- 3Meqf99iY6hKUcqNFoTYDZ5JPp4oG7g2jP